Transaction 17278908cec7d23e93a7c56188ba569139234ee9530031bc358e17b2b8867eb7
1 Input
1 Output
-
17278908cec7d23e93a7c56188ba569139234ee9530031bc358e17b2b8867eb7:0
- value
- 892826
- script pubkey
- OP_0 OP_PUSHBYTES_20 1218eeed79fe5c602e4b3d245d6581e5214e00ad
- address
- bc1qzgvwamtelewxqtjt85j96evpu5s5uq9dqy98jy